Winning is always nice, but doing so behind a season-high score is even better (just ask Lakeshore). They put the hurt on the Franklinton Demons with a sharp 18-3 win on Thursday. Lakeshore hasn't had any issues with Franklinton recently, as the game was their fourth consecutive victory against them.
Annabella Litolff was a major factor while hitting and pitching. She looked comfortable on the mound, striking out nine batters over seven innings while giving up just two earned (and one unearned) runs off five hits. Those nine strikeouts gave her a new career-high. She was also solid in the batter's box, scoring three runs and stealing a base while going 1-for-5.
In other batting news, Julia Haddad was incredible, going 4-for-6 with one home run, six RBI, and three runs. Jaycee Ray was another key player, scoring three runs while going 4-for-6.
Lakeshore was getting hits left and right and finished the game having posted a batting average of .478. That's the best batting average they've posted all season.
The win got Lakeshore back to even at 6-6. As for Franklinton, this is the second loss in a row for them and nudges their season record down to 5-8.
Coming up, Lakeshore will be playing at home against St. Thomas Aquinas at 4:30 p.m. on Monday. St. Thomas Aquinas has struggled to contain batters this season (they've allowed 12.18 runs per game on average), something Lakeshore will no doubt try to take advantage of. As for Franklinton, they will venture away from home to square off against De La Salle at 12:00 p.m. on Saturday.
